Abstract

This Special Problem focused on the arrangements of the integers 1.2 rn into r circles k1, k2…..kn each containing n elements) such that none of them (including rn and 1) are consecutive in the clockwise order. Expressions representing the number of such arrangements were obtained for r = 1.2.3 and 4 and a general formula was formulated.
